Datamatics Global Services Limited has announced its unaudited standalone and consolidated financial results for the quarter ended June 30, 2026. These results were approved by the Board of Directors at a meeting held on Wednesday, August 5, 2026.

The financial results were published on Friday, August 7, 2026, in the newspapers Financial Express (in English) and Mumbai Lakshadweep (in Marathi), as required by SEBI (Listing Obligations &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015. The company has also made this information available on its website, www.datamatics.com, for public access. The announcement was made by Divya Kumat, President, Chief Legal Officer, and Company Secretary.
